Periodontal disease is very widespread. In fact, studies from the Centers for Disease Control reveal that half of adults over thirty require treatment for periodontal concerns. Without treatment, gum disease could impact smile stability. Also known as periodontal disease, this is actually the most common cause of adult tooth loss. All that to say, when you develop the symptoms of the disease, you should seek help right away. Inflamed and receding gums, especially with bleeding, are common indicators that you need to consult a Yosemite Valley dental practice.

If there is any sign of periodontal concerns, then a treatment plan can be created. For less severe cases, a scaling and root planing followed by traditional cleanings every 3 to 4 months could help you avoid tooth loss. For severe periodontitis stages, there are options like gum grafts, laser dentistry, and more to protect your smile!

Grownups are not the only ones who benefit from regular dental care. Kids require routine preventive dentistry as well, and they need to be monitored by a pediatric dentist for signs of threats to their oral health. This could include dental malocclusion, or for teens, wisdom tooth eruption. Checkups and cleanings should begin when all baby teeth come in, and should not be skipped. These visits enable your Yosemite Valley pediatric dentist to watch the smile over time, and if areas of concern develop, such as tooth decay, or gingivitis, then treatment can be administered. In addition, kids can often receive fluoride treatments to strengthen the outer enamel of their dentition and prevent tooth decay. Dental sealants, which coat the grooves on top of the back molars, can protect teeth for years to come. In fact, sealants can provide protection against tooth cavities for as long as ten years in some cases.

When winter ends, people start going out more and enjoying the beautiful weather, and of course, we want to look our best when we socialize, which is why many people seek cosmetic dentistry. Cosmetic dentistry refers to procedures designed purely to correct common esthetic issues. Teeth stains can be removed, and teeth crowding or gaps between the teeth can be corrected with braces. Correcting your smile starts with a consultation with your cosmetic dentist in Yosemite Valley, CA. The doctor will carefully assess your cosmetic concerns. Using digital technology for a precise diagnosis, the dentist will assess the cause and extent of your esthetic concerns in order to come up with a personalized treatment plan. For stains, professional teeth whitening could brighten smiles by several shades. Dental bonding and contouring can repair teeth and mask imperfections in one visit. Gum contouring utilizes laser technology to reshape the gum line and correct gummy smiles. Porcelain veneers are thin restorations that change a tooth’s shape and color, and for those with uneven teeth, Invisalign® may be possible.

According to studies by the CDC, over half of adults older than the age of thirty suffer from gingival disease. Without treatment, this condition could lead to painful symptoms, including sore gums. The advanced stage, referred to as periodontitis, could also cause the loss of your teeth. How does the disease start? The early stages of periodontitis could occur due to poor oral hygiene habits. Some could develop it due to infrequent dental cleanings, or due to gingivitis, tobacco use, certain medications, or even a family history of the disease. As we touched on above, tell-tell signs include changes to your gingival tissues including soreness and bleeding. In addition to offering biannual dental checkups and cleanings, pediatric dentists on Doctors Network also provide your child with dental sealants. These are thin pieces of film that go over their molars. They work as a protective film that forms a protective layer between their adult molars and harmful germs. This ultimately prevents the risk of decay by up to 80%. It is a simple procedure that is very effective at preventing the need for fillings in the future.


Fluoride treatments are another great tool that your kids’ dentists provide. Fluoride is a naturally occurring mineral that helps fortify your children’s teeth. While enamel is one of the most durable substances our bodies produce, it can still weaken over time. When this occurs, your kid’s teeth become more susceptible to decay. Many people would prefer to have a whiter smile. When you walk down the aisles of any pharmacy, you see countless products that advertise their teeth whitening abilities. If you have purchased any of these, you know that they almost always provide lackluster results. However, professional tooth whitening can actually produce a brighter smile. When you visit your Yosemite Valley dentist, they can provide you with either an at-home or in-office treatment. Should you opt for treatment in the office, you will only have to stay for roughly an hour. When you visit the office for whitening, your dentist will apply a special bleaching gel that, when activated by a special light, will get rid of stains.

If you would prefer to go with an at-home treatment, your dentist will give you a set of custom trays that you can fill with a safe peroxide or bleaching solution. You will put these on for a couple of hours each day for about two weeks. Once this treatment is over, you will have a more radiant smile.
